Claremont Hotel - Blackpool
53.82474, -3.05516Offering a baggage storage and a store, this 2-star Claremont Hotel Blackpool lies in North Shore district, approximately a 17-minute stroll from Promenade and 1.5 miles from the restored Victorian North Pier.
Rooms
Furnished with a writing table, the 143 rooms include conveniences like television with satellite channels along with ironing facilities. Together with a bathtub, a separate toilet and showers, bathroom comforts also include hair dryers and bath sheets. Some rooms come with fantastic views of the sea.
Eat & Drink
Claremont Hotel features a buffet breakfast daily in the bar. This property features an à la carte restaurant, offering international cuisine. The lounge bar serves refreshing drinks daily. Guests will enjoy British meals at The Promenade Cafe, which is 0.2 miles away.
Leisure & Business
A play area and a children club are available for guests with children.
Internet
Wireless internet is available in public areas for free.
